[0029] Examples, see e.g. Figure 1 to Figure 8 As shown, an equidistant glass cutting device includes a case 11 with an opening on the right side, a rotating shaft 12 is hinged between the front side wall and the rear side wall of the case 11, and large gears are fixed on the rotating shaft 12 from front to back. 13. The middle gear 14 and the pinion 15, the large gear 13 meshes with the first rack 16 arranged in the left and right directions, the middle gear 14 meshes with the second rack 17, the pinion 15 meshes with the third rack 18, and the middle gear 14 meshes with the third rack 18. Both the second rack 17 and the third rack 18 are arranged parallel to the first rack 16, and the second rack 17, the third rack 18 and the first rack 16 are slidably connected to the left side wall of the cabinet 11, The second tooth bar 17, the third tooth bar 18 and the first tooth bar 16 pass through the left extension end of the cabinet 11 and are respectively fixed with a glass knife...
